Getting to the point I bought a Firehawk and I love it, but after a few weeks I have found that the Expression Pedal has an intermittent mechanical clicking sound when rocking back and forth on it. I can 100% say that I have never put full weight on it as I am a guy of medium build so I always make sure that I keep the weight on my left leg and light pressure on the pedal.

 

I just wondered if anyone else has experience this as it just doesn't sound right, so I am wondering if this can be adjusted out using the supply allen key or should I just return the unit for a replacement.

You are not alone. I have found that the noise can be eliminated with +-zero pressure (just barely move from heel to toe without pressing).

I am also using two Ernie Ball Jr. as a 2nd expression pedal for FH and M13 respectively, consisting of a simple string mechanism, and they have  not made any noise for the past couple of years. I guess it is how it is designed.
